Output 53e22eeabbe5adc6c44d152bb7a145d8815babf20c94e63986811724c0309795:0

value
269174063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e3cc393a4401ed0056d35e1701806d093a0bfe2 OP_EQUALVERIFY OP_CHECKSIG
address
1B3t84FkFYmskt9XffBYAUUWAm5UgFz5Hg
transaction
53e22eeabbe5adc6c44d152bb7a145d8815babf20c94e63986811724c0309795
spent
true